Another day, another adventure. Today i am trying to keep a restaurant POS system alive on new hardware. The system is Aloha POS and it is currently running in a Windows 98 second edition box from the stone ages.
1. Virtual Box – Forget about it, very bad support for Video. Two suggested options, a beta project driver and an old video utilitiy that has no support either. BOOHOO.
2. Paralells Virtual Desktop 4.0 – Cost $79 per station – No good, ARGH!! If your machine doesn’t have a processor that supports virtualization, your done.
3. Microsoft Virtual PC – Trying it now, everything seems to work great, but the touch screen support is not working correctly yet, nor do i think it will. Looks like a delay problem between the screen and the virtual machine. Best and cleanest install so far.
4. VMWare Workstation – Cost $199 – Interesting bug, the PCI Standard Bridge seems to be caught in a loop, but go with it, 32 times later it will install and move along on the installation. Still working on this one.
